Just got my truck, never had anything uconnect in my life. Feel like I should be prepared if something happens.

I looked through all of the paperwork, books etc. I don't have a radio code.

Are these susceptible to requiring a radio code just if the battery dies? Or is needing a code just for transfer?
Searching, what I find are swaps that require a code, but i haven't found anything related to a battery dying and asking for a code. Just want to make sure so I won't be pulling my (the little remaining) hair out in a pinch.

The radio info is written to the truck computer at factory install. even if you lost power, it'll still retain. however, if you swap the radio for another.. then you will need a radio code. Some dealers would be nice enough to give it to you for free while others wont.
